Krista M. Stirk is a scholar working on Organic Chemistry, Atomic and Molecular Physics, and Optics and Spectroscopy. According to data from OpenAlex, Krista M. Stirk has authored 11 papers receiving a total of 485 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Organic Chemistry, 3 papers in Atomic and Molecular Physics, and Optics and 3 papers in Spectroscopy. Recurrent topics in Krista M. Stirk’s work include Radical Photochemical Reactions (5 papers), Mass Spectrometry Techniques and Applications (3 papers) and Advanced Chemical Physics Studies (3 papers). Krista M. Stirk is often cited by papers focused on Radical Photochemical Reactions (5 papers), Mass Spectrometry Techniques and Applications (3 papers) and Advanced Chemical Physics Studies (3 papers). Krista M. Stirk collaborates with scholars based in United States. Krista M. Stirk's co-authors include Hilkka I. Kenttämaa, Rebecca L. Smith, Pirjo Vainiotalo, Leonard J. Chyall, Kami K. Thoen, Thilini D. Ranatunga and John T. Farrell and has published in prestigious journals such as Chemical Reviews, Journal of the American Chemical Society and Rapid Communications in Mass Spectrometry.
